Royal Mail's Threat to Lifeline Postbus Services

Lodged by John Farquhar Munro Standard Motion 5 supporters

The motion

That the Parliament recognises the valuable social role that the postbus service plays in remote areas of the west and north Highlands; therefore notes with regret the decision by the Royal Mail to withdraw the three postbus routes in the west Highlands from Diabaig to Achnasheen, Applecross to Torridon and Torridon to Strathcarron and two routes in the far north of Scotland from Thurso to Tongue and Tongue to Bettyhill; considers that the Royal Mail is unwilling to negotiate further with Highland Council over this matter and continues to avoid the issue, and asks the Scottish Government to step in and secure the postbus service, which is vital to many people in these communities.
